The Adam Small festival of 2025 will take place from 21 to 23 February in Pniël. Tie the date in your ear!
Join us for a unique feast honoring Afrikaans most iconic voices, Adam Small. His brilliant contributions to literature and his voice for social justice are being commemorated in a meaningful way this weekend.

Youth Day

Posted by Chayan Singh on 16 June 2021 5:00 AM CAT
Default user photo

Youth Day commemorates the Soweto Uprising, which took place on 16 June 1976, where thousands of students were ambushed by the apartheid regime. On Youth DaySouth Africans pay tribute to the lives of these students and recognises the role of the youth in the liberation of South Africa from the apartheid regime.
